Which gravel types work best for freeze-thaw durability and drainage at about 8,000 ft elevation?
For Buena Vista’s high-elevation freeze-thaw cycles, use angular, crushed rock that locks together (for example crushed granite or crushed limestone) for driveways and base layers, and washed gravel or 1–2u0022 drain rock where you need drainage. Avoid only- rounded river rock or loose pea gravel for high-traffic or snowy areas since they move and hold ice. Also pair gravel with a compacted base, good surface slope, and sub-surface drainage to reduce frost heave.
How many tons of gravel do I need per 100 sq ft at common depths (2u0022, 3u0022, 4u0022) in Buena Vista?
Use these rough estimates for 100 sq ft: 2u0022 depth ≈ 0.9 tons, 3u0022 depth ≈ 1.3 tons, and 4u0022 depth ≈ 1.7 tons. For driveways a typical finished surface is 3u0022–4u0022 over a compacted base, while pads that need vehicle weight or RVs usually require a thicker base (4u0022–6u0022) and more tons. Always order a bit extra (5%–10%) to allow for compaction, grading, and local irregularities.
Which gravel works best for Buena Vista driveways, patios, and RV pads given local terrain?
For driveways in Buena Vista, a compactable base mix (crusher run or 3/4u0022 minus) topped with 3/4u0022 crushed stone or 3/8u0022–1/2u0022 chip stone gives good lock and traction. Patios and walkways benefit from finer, screened gravel or decomposed granite for a smoother finish, while RV pads need a thicker compacted base—typically crusher run under a 3/4u0022 wearing layer. For steep or erosion-prone sites, add geotextile fabric and edge restraint to keep material in place.

How often will a gravel driveway in Buena Vista need maintenance and what extends its life?
A gravel driveway in Buena Vista typically needs light maintenance (regrading, filling ruts, and adding 1/2u0022–1u0022 of material) every 1–3 years, with more substantial refreshes every 3–7 years depending on traffic and snowplow use. To extend life, maintain good drainage, use an appropriate base mix, compact properly at installation, add edge restraints, and avoid cutting snow down to subgrade when plowing. Promptly repair washouts or ponding to prevent frost heave and erosion.
How does gravel compare to asphalt, concrete, and pavers for rural Buena Vista driveways?
Gravel has the lowest initial cost and is permeable, which helps with drainage in mountain climates, but it requires more ongoing maintenance than asphalt, concrete, or pavers. Asphalt and concrete cost more up front, perform better under heavy traffic, and need less frequent resurfacing, while pavers offer the most aesthetics and longevity but at higher cost. For rural Buena Vista properties with changing terrain and drainage needs, gravel is often the practical choice if you’re willing to maintain it and install proper base and drainage.
What gravel mixes are popular in West Colorado for driveways and erosion control?
Popular mixes include crusher run (a compactable mix of crushed stone and fines) for base layers and driveways, washed 3/4u0022 or 1–2u0022 rock for drainage, and decorative washed gravel or pea gravel for patios and landscaping. Crusher run is commonly used on slopes and driveways because it compacts and resists movement; washed rock is used for swales and dry creek beds to prevent fines from washing away. How should I prepare my site in Buena Vista before gravel delivery to minimize problems?
Prep the site by clearing vegetation and debris, establishing positive drainage (1%–2% slope away from structures), and installing edge restraints or a compacted subbase if you expect vehicle traffic. Mark the preferred drop area, confirm access for a tri-axle dump truck, and add turning space if needed; notify Hello Gravel of any driveway restrictions when you order.
